Administrative law - appeal to Federal Court from Administrative Appeals Tribunal - application for student pilot's licence - applicant admitted to have suffered one psychotic episode - whether evidence of established medical history of psychosis - whether applicant's submission raised question of law - whether meaning of certain Air Navigation Orders made pursuant to regulations under Air Navigation Act 1920 restricted by the Chicago Convention approved by that Act - Administrative Appeals Act 1975, s.44 - Air Navigation Act 1920, ss.3A and 26 - Air Navigation Regulations, reg.57 - Air Navigation Orders, s.47.1.
